Output fd332bff375f80cf938b7afbe3da9d9c29d5eac227fd3b2880289ca323b6b9ba:30

value
151893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e823150f2ab152ad8f1c5689b26cca97ca44d3d OP_EQUAL
address
3AJjQX4bAhwBpVxfcYUXRgweDnLtdaPTRz
transaction
fd332bff375f80cf938b7afbe3da9d9c29d5eac227fd3b2880289ca323b6b9ba
confirmations
261138
spent
true